Globe is beefing up its site upgrades in the province of Guimaras, known as the mango capital of the Philippines.
As part of its commitment to improve network connectivity in the country, Globe is eyeing to complete the modernization of its 4G LTE network in 43 locations across the island province by September.
“We wanted to make our presence felt in areas that initially we don’t have a strong foothold. We would like to assure our customers that Globe will have additional installations and site upgrades for more parts of Western Visayas for the whole year,” said Joel Agustin, Globe Senior Vice President for Program Delivery, Network Technical Group.
